TonyJob
01 公链测试 base:线上办公
工作职责:
1、测试计划设计与实施:
设计针对公链环境的全面测试计划和策略。
开发针对共识算法、智能合约、节点性能和网络安全的测试用例。
2、自动化与工具开发:
构建并维护区块链组件(包括 API、共识协议、智能合约)的自动化测试框架。
开发压力测试工具,以模拟高流量场景和网络拥堵情况。
3、共识与协议验证:
测试并验证共识机制(如 PoS、PoW、BFT)的正确性、容错性和性能。
对区块链协议进行端到端测试,并验证状态转换的准确性。
4、安全与漏洞测试:
执行渗透测试,识别区块链和智能合约生态系统中的漏洞。
确保符合安全最佳实践,并降低风险。
5、性能测试:
基准测试并优化节点性能(延迟、吞吐量、内存使用)。
分析网络性能指标,如每秒交易量(TPS)和区块传播时间。
工作要求:
1、深入了解区块链技术,包括公链、共识机制和密码学。
2、熟练掌握至少一种编程语言(如 Python、Rust、Go、JavaScript)。
3、有使用区块链框架(如 Ethereum、Cosmos SDK、Polkadot 或类似框架)的经验。
4、测试技能:
有自动化工具(如 Selenium、Puppeteer、Cypress)和测试框架的实际操作经验。
熟悉智能合约测试工具(如 Postman、Hardhat、Truffle 或 Remix)。
了解负载测试和性能分析工具(如 Apache JMeter、Locust)。
薪资:open
(扫码投递,咨询详情)
关注公众号,进入招聘群
关于 TonyJob
专注于区块链(web3)领域招聘服务
找 web3 工作,找 TonyJob!
【免责声明】市场有风险,投资需谨慎。本文不构成投资建议,用户应考虑本文中的任何意见、观点或结论是否符合其特定状况。据此投资,责任自负。